What companies run services between Pune, India and Jālna, India?

Purple Bus operates a bus from Shivajinagar to Jalna Sharma Travels 5 times a day. Tickets cost ₹800–2,200 and the journey takes 6h 40m. King Luxuries also services this route once daily. Alternatively, you can take a train from Pune Jn to Jalna via Manmad Jn in around 8h 55m.
